extract.local.NLDAS.Rd
This function extracts NLDAS data from grids that have been downloaded and stored locally. Once upon a time, you could query these files directly from the internet, but now they're behind a tricky authentication wall. Files are saved as a netCDF file in CF conventions. These files are ready to be used in the general PEcAn workflow or fed into the downscalign workflow.
extract.local.NLDAS(outfolder, in.path, start_date, end_date, site_id, lat.in, lon.in, overwrite = FALSE, verbose = FALSE, ...)
outfolder | - directory where output files will be stored |
---|---|
in.path | - path to the raw full grids |
start_date | - first day for which you want to extract met (yyyy-mm-dd) |
end_date | - last day for which you want to extract met (yyyy-mm-dd) |
site_id | name to associate with extracted files |
lat.in | site latitude in decimal degrees |
lon.in | site longitude in decimal degrees |
overwrite | logical. Download a fresh version even if a local file with the same name already exists? |
verbose | logical. Passed on to |
... | Other arguments, currently ignored |
